Q1: Please Introduce Yourself To Our Community

Hello, thank you so much for taking the time to interview me. I’ve spent most of my career as an advertising account executive in New York City advertising agencies. I currently share my home with two rescue tabbies Kip and Haddie.

My blog, I Have Cat, began as a passion project. Growing up I was involved in all sorts of activities relating to the arts – ballet, violin, theater. But once I moved to New York City and started working longer and longer hours I didn’t pursue any of them.

One day as I was regaling a friend with humorous cat stories she suggested I start a blog. I’d never considered myself a writer but I gave it a shot with her help figuring only my close friends and family would ever read it. It was fun to start meeting people from all over the world through the blog and associated social media platforms – we have rather large Facebook, Twitter and Instagram communities.

Q2: Tell More About The Inspiration Shop Cats Of New York?

Jack, a cat living in a wine store a block from me, was the first shop cat I encountered. By chance he actually made it into the book as the very first chapter! Kitty, who lives in a Pilates studio, is the other neighborhood cat who helped inspire the book.

My cat loving friends living in NYC would often tell me about or share photos of cats in a variety of businesses in their neighborhoods. Many people seemed to be aware of bodega cats (deli cats) but there didn’t seem to be much coverage about cats living in different business who were beloved and very well cared for. Cats living in places like bike shops, real estate offices and even dog boutiques!

Q3: What Do You Think Made Shop Cats Of New York Such A Big Hit?

I think it’s a great combination of two well liked and popular topics – cats and NYC! These cats have stories to tell and create a sense of community in what can often feel like a large and impersonal city.

It’s also a visually stunning book (if I don’t say so myself!). The photos were taken by my friend Andrew Marttila, a popular cat photographer with the handle @iamthegreatwent on Instagram, and HarperDesigns (of HarperCollins) designed the hardcover book. I love the literal feel of the book!
